CVE-2024-32896

Exp

there is a possible way to bypass due to a logic error in the code. This could lead to local escalation of privilege with no additional execution privileges needed. User interaction is needed for exploitation.

CISA KEV Record for CVE-2024-32896

Name: Android Pixel Privilege Escalation Vulnerability · CISA KEV detail

Exploit added: 2024-06-13

Action due: 2024-07-04

Required action: Apply mitigations per vendor instructions or discontinue use of the product if mitigations are unavailable.
